Horizon Zero Dawn: What they didn't show at the conference + Interview (PS Access)

Alo0oy

Banned
Playstation Access just uploaded those two videos for Horizon Zero Dawn.

Interview:
https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=D_p4u8xIQxo

What they didn't show at the conference:
https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=gdGgeGY6nLc

- The Thunderjaw has 550k polygons.
- It has 93 plates of armor that can be attacked individually.
- It has two major weak points, the "power core" in the heart, & "AI Core" in the head.
- The game is "very much an RPG".
- You can "quick craft" arrow heads for the bow.
- There's towns, villages, & quests.
- Crafting is a major component of the game.
- The game is targeting 2016.
- The combat is described as "tactical".
- Every single location seen in the trailer is explorable.
- The RPG elements will not slow down the combat.
- Aloy's "job" is a machine huntress.
- The "Combat" & "RPG" are both very big parts of the game.

A lot of that is old info, but there's some new info as well.

Few notes made as I was listening. Reiterates a lot of detail you might have heard elsewhere:

  • They saw a live demo of the same section we saw from the gameplay trailer
  • No loading screens
  • Open world hunting which they compare to The Witcher
  • It's an RPG at heart but their focus is on action. It's not intended to be deep
  • There's a system called quick-craft to be used in battle to create things like arrows
  • They describe the combat as tactical, so there will be lots of options of how to bring down enemies using Aloy's tools and weapons
  • The E3 demo shows Aloy (pronounced 'Ey-loy') on a quest she got from a village to harvest resources from the grazing deer-like machines
  • In the playthrough they saw, the player laid a rope trap for the deer machines which exploded a bunch of them before they could escape
  • The big T-Rex one is called the Thunderjaw. Made from over 550,000 polygons. 93 different hit-plates; i.e. all destructible elements on its armour
  • The Thunderjaw in the demo was not at full health as it has been battling another tribe previously
  • The mystery of the machines is a driving force behind the game
  • Due in 2016
